About Astrotech Corporation

Astrotech Corporation operates as a mass spectrometry company worldwide. It owns and licenses the intellectual property related to the Astrotech Mass Spectrometer Technology, a platform mass spectrometry technology. The company also develops TRACER 1000, a mass spectrometer-based explosive trace detector to replace the explosives trace detectors used at airports, border checkpoints, cargo hubs, infrastructure security, correctional facilities, military bases, and law enforcement centers. In addition, it develops AGLAB-1000, a mass spectrometer for use in the hemp and cannabis market. Further, the company develops BreathTest-1000, a breath analysis tool to screen for volatile organic compound metabolites found in a person's breath; and Pro-Control 1000-D2, a mass spectrometer; and EN-SCAN to detect soil, water, and air contamination source location and migration. The company was formerly known as SPACEHAB, Inc. and changed its name to Astrotech Corporation in 2009. The company was incorporated in 1984 and is based in Austin, Texas.
